Transaction 6593f6b5f5ff1e8efb511a22967b140ea57af570d8d1be449033aa8b941e88dc

3 Input
1 Outputs
  • 6593f6b5f5ff1e8efb511a22967b140ea57af570d8d1be449033aa8b941e88dc:0
  • value  1526210
    address  16wcSFKnbQN2LadPxPVccJ6kZDYNdxKQod